Where to stay in Basel

Find the best Basel are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Altstadt Grossbasel

Step into Basel's Altstadt Grossbasel, a medieval treasure where cobblestone streets wind past colorful Renaissance buildings. The towering Basel Minster cathedral overlooks lively Marktplatz, where market stalls gather beneath the ornate red Town Hall. This car-free district makes exploring the city's rich history a pleasure on foot. Art enthusiasts will find paradise in the neighborhood's exceptional museums. The Kunstmuseum Basel and Basel Historical Museum showcase centuries of cultural heritage. Traditional Swiss restaurants serve authentic fondue in historic guild houses, while boutique shops offer local crafts and chocolates.

Kleinbasel

Across the Rhine from Basel's Old Town, Kleinbasel offers a refreshing mix of multicultural charm and riverside beauty. The cobblestone streets wind past colorful buildings where locals outnumber tourists. Summer brings swimmers to the Rhine's clean waters while traditional wooden ferries glide silently between banks. Discover art at Museum Tinguely or browse independent boutiques along Klybeckstrasse. Diverse restaurants serve everything from Swiss rösti to Turkish döner at neighborhood prices. Excellent tram connections make exploring easy, but the peaceful riverfront promenades invite you to slow down.

Sankt Alban

Sankt Alban whispers tales of medieval Basel through its iconic gate and ancient paper mills. Narrow cobblestone streets wind between historic buildings, revealing centuries of stories. The peaceful Rhine promenade offers scenic walks with views of historic bridges and glittering waters. This upscale residential haven balances preserved history with authentic Swiss living. Elegant homes and local cafés provide glimpses into Basel's refined character. Excellent tram connections make exploring the wider city remarkably simple.

Clara

Clara blends multicultural charm with residential tranquility just minutes from Basel's city center. Locals shop at neighborhood markets while children play in tree-lined streets. This welcoming district offers an authentic glimpse into everyday Swiss life away from tourist crowds. The neighborhood sits near Badischer Bahnhof railway station with excellent tram connections throughout the city. Discover family-run restaurants serving diverse cuisines that reflect the area's cultural mix. Clara's quiet evenings and modest parks create a peaceful retreat after exploring Basel's livelier districts.

Basel City Centre

Basel City Centre blends medieval charm with cultural richness across its pedestrian-friendly streets. The 12th-century Basel Minster cathedral stands majestically among historic buildings and lively squares. Cobblestone pathways lead to hidden treasures throughout this artistic hub. World-class museums like the Kunstmuseum showcase impressive collections in this Swiss cultural capital. Hop on frequent trams at Marktplatz or University stops for easy exploration. The flowing Rhine adds natural beauty to this walkable district filled with Swiss heritage.

Best time to go to Basel

The best time to visit Basel is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January34.9°F (1.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
May56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July67.8°F (19.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August67.3°F (19.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November43.2°F (6.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Basel

Traveling to Basel, Switzerland, is convenient with access to three major airports. Basel (BSL-EuroAirport) is located 6.4km from the city and offers nearby accommodations such as the 4-star Mercure Bale Mulhouse Aeroport and Hotel Villa K - Basel Airport. Zürich Airport (ZRH) is 74.0km away, with luxury options like the Zurich Marriott Hotel and Kameha Grand Zurich, both 2 to 8.0km from the airport. Finally, Mulhouse (MLH-EuroAirport) is also 6.4km from Basel, featuring hotels like ibis Mulhouse Bale Aeroport and Hôtel Berlioz, located just 1 to 3.2km away. Each airport provides accessible transportation to these hotels, ensuring a smooth arrival.

What's the weather like in Basel?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 65°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 38°F. Average annual precipitation for Basel is 39 inches.
